Alright, I received very few information about W.E.B. Darkness Alive,” I only know it was captured at Gagarin205 in the band’s hometown of Athens on September 22nd, 2024. That’s it. Well, the band has something to say:

We shared the stage that night with Dark Funeral, and since we were making changes within the band that had us excited, we made the decision to mark this day with a special release, hence our first official live album,” says singer/guitarist Sakis Prekas.

Ok, then, being this one my first time with W.E.B. I have to say I was impressed by the quality of their music. “Darkness Alive” has more variations and shifts than the regular Symphonic Death Metal album. For instance, album’s first kill “Crimson Dawn” delivers a huge violin intro with some cinematic elements. Dark Web,” on the other hand, delivers a pretty pungent Extreme Metal force combined with very few Symphonic Metal elements. Here the more important feature is the heavyness. There some hidden keyboarding that gives the song an even more mysterious mood. Dragona follows the same path being even heavier with very organic and simple guitars. The shifts in tempo and mood make it one of the best tracks of the album. Other times, the band delivers a kind of taunted weird melody as in Murder Of Crows which, from where I am standing, works pretty fine.

After listening to “Darkness Alive” I got the impression that all tracks are somehow linked, I mean, they seem to tell the same story. Maybe it is an effect of the alive album. That’s the impression I got.

W.E.B. Darkness Alive” will be released on February 20th via Metal Blade Records.
